I have an Outlander 2011 model 2.4 L engine with CVT and will never buy the Outlander new model again due to the following:
1- unconfortable suspension, hard like a rock which makes the vehicle jiggling like Christmas bell.

2- annoying CVT which jumps to the 5th gear once the speed reaches 15 miles so you start feeling the vibration if smoothly accelerate or I have to hardly accelerate to push the gear to down shift but the car runs faster then I want, imagine this in traffic jam you will hate driving it. Needless to mention the vibration damage to the vehicle parts in a short time period.

3- all the interior is made out of cheap plastic, the vehicle will not make the first year before start falling apart in the inside.

Our 2011 is fine. The suspension is not bad and it is not as harshly damped as our old Seat Freetrack was. The springs feel softer than the Seat too. So it does roll a little more but it is anything but harsh compared to the more sporty set up feel of the Seat.

Ours is a 2.2 diesel manual box so there is no issues with this side of it although it does reccomend we shift gear at about 1800rpm with a shift indicator on the dash.

The plastics have been fine since 2011 so I dont see a problem there as its 6 years old and nothing has broken yet.

Is it our perfect car? No... But then if we wanted it to be perfect we would need 3 different cars. Is it a good car? Yes, it will tow our caravan, carry our Mountain bikes too and is 4x4 so we can take our caravan on grassy campsites. It will be fine in the snow (if we get any) and it will carry all we need in comfort.
